Great Falls Crossing is a locality in Fairfax County, Virginia, United States. It has a population of approximately 1,414. The population density is 896.2 people per km². Great Falls Crossing is located at 38.9808°N, 77.3256°W. It observes the Eastern Time (America/New_York) timezone. ZIP code: 20194.
